The SHARKBITE/CASH ACME 23055 is a dedicated crimp ring removal tool designed to cut away copper crimp rings from PEX pipe without damaging the barbed insert fitting underneath. When a mis-installation occurs, this tool gives plumbers a fast, controlled way to strip the crimped connection and recover the fitting for reuse. The tool works by inserting the stub end into the fitting, positioning the cutting blade on the outside of the PEX pipe, and squeezing the handles to slice cleanly through the pipe wall. The fitting can be reused if it is found to be undamaged after removal.
This tool is used in residential and light commercial plumbing applications wherever PEX pipe is joined with copper crimp rings over barbed insert fittings. It is the appropriate corrective tool when a crimp ring is placed incorrectly, out of position, or needs to be removed for any other service reason. Plumbers working with PEX-A, PEX-B, or PEX-C distribution systems will find this tool useful during both new construction and retrofit work. Each package contains 6 units.
Designed for use with copper crimp rings installed over barbed insert PEX fittings in standard PEX plumbing systems.
This tool is used by licensed plumbers during corrective service on PEX crimp-ring connections. Before beginning removal, shut off water supply to the affected line and relieve system pressure. Cut the PEX pipe as close to the end of the barbed insert fitting as possible before inserting the tool, and open the tool fully before placing the stub end into the fitting. Inspect the barbed insert fitting carefully for damage before reinstalling a new crimp ring and connection.
